CR 23-83 1Committee ReportRecommending FIRST READING of Bill 92 (2023) to amend the Fiscal Year 2024 Budget by amending Section 3.B.9.a., Department of Management, Management Program, by increasing the equivalent personnel by 1.0, decreasing the appropriation under General - Category B (Operations and Equipment) by $40,000, increasing the appropriation for the Grant to Maui County Veterans Council by $40,000, and adjusting the totals accordingly.   Action details Video Video
CR 23-84 1Committee ReportRecommending ADOPTION of Resolution 23-130, authorizing settlement of Claim 4077284 of Ronald Browning, in the amount of $18,107.70, relating to property damage in Kula.   Action details Video Video
CR 23-85 1Committee ReportRecommending ADOPTION of Resolution 23-109, authorizing settlement of Claim 4077471 of Joel Estrella, in the amount of $15,000, relating to property damage in Wailuku.   Action details Not available
CR 23-86 1Committee ReportRecommending ADOPTION of Resolution 23-110, authorizing settlement of Claim 4076201 of David Williams, in the amount of $29,046.04, relating to property damage in Kihei.   Action details Not available
CR 23-87 1Committee ReportRecommending ADOPTION of Resolution 23-111, authorizing settlement of Claim 4080968 of Matthew Smith, in the amount of $25,000, relating to erroneous billing for sewer fees at the claimant’s property in Lahaina.   Action details Not available
CR 23-88 1Committee ReportRecommending ADOPTION of Resolution 23-113, authorizing settlement of Claim 4076130 of Hansen Ohana Security LLC (Robert Hansen), in the amount of $14,982.67, relating to property damage in Kihei.   Action details Not available
CR 23-89 1Committee ReportRecommending FIRST READING of Bill 73 (2023), authorizing the Mayor to enter into a Memorandum of Agreement with the State of Hawai?i, County of Maui, County of Hawai‘i, County of Kaua‘i, City and County of Honolulu, and the County of Kalawao, on proceeds relating to settlement of opioid litigation.   Action details Video Video
CR 23-90 1Committee ReportRecommending FIRST READING of Bill 87, CD1 (2023), to assist the Department of Transportation with implementing a paid parking system by establishing off-street paid parking zones and permit parking zones in Wailuku, establish prohibited activities for the Wailuku garage, and propose amendments to assist the Department in enforcing rules and laws on the general operation of paid and permit parking.   Action details Video Video
CR 23-91 1Committee ReportRecommending FIRST READING of Bill 89 (2023), to authorize the Mayor to enter into an intergovernmental agreement with the United States Geological Survey, Pacific Islands Water Science Center, United States Department of the Interior, to continue its cooperative water-resource monitoring program in a joint funding agreement with the Department of Water Supply.   Action details Video Video
Reso 23-222 1Resolution"APPROVING DISPOSITION (PARTIAL CANCELLATION) OF WATERLINE EASEMENT" The purpose of this resolution is to terminate a portion of a waterline easement burdening Lot 218-A in the Maui Lani Subdivision.   Action details Video Video
Reso 23-226 1Resolution"URGING THE MAYOR TO ESTABLISH A HOUSING COORDINATOR FOR MAUI COUNTY"   Action details Video Video
Bill 103 (2023) 1Bill"A BILL FOR AN ORDINANCE ON THE REAL PROPERTY TAX AGRICULTURAL CLASSIFICATION AND DEDICATED LANDS FOR AGRICULTURAL USE" The purpose of this bill is to tier the agricultural real property tax classification and require the Director of Finance to seek assistance from the Department of Agriculture with verification that lands dedicated to agriculture use comply with dedication requirements.   Action details Video Video
Bill 104 (2023) 1Bill"A BILL FOR AN ORDINANCE AMENDING SECTION 3.100.040, MAUI COUNTY CODE, ON USE OF THE GENERAL EXCISE TAX FUND" The purpose of this bill is to require that private recipients allow the County to audit their financial records.   Action details Not available
Bill 105 (2023) 1Bill"A BILL FOR AN ORDINANCE AMENDING THE FISCAL YEAR 2024 BUDGET FOR THE COUNTY OF MAUI, APPENDIX A, PART I, DEPARTMENT OF FIRE AND PUBLIC SAFETY" The purpose of this bill is to amend the Fiscal Year 2024 Budget, Department of Fire and Public Safety; State of Hawai?i, Makena Lifeguard Services by increasing the appropriated amount by $80,001.   Action details Video Video
Bill 106 (2023) 1Bill"A BILL FOR AN ORDINANCE AMENDING THE FISCAL YEAR 2024 BUDGET FOR THE COUNTY OF MAUI, DEPARTMENT OF WATER SUPPLY, ADMINISTRATION PROGRAM; CAPITAL IMPROVEMENT PROJECTS AND APPENDIX C, DEPARTMENT OF WATER SUPPLY" The purpose of this bill is to amend the Fiscal Year 2024 Budget, Department of Water Supply, Administration Program by: 1) decreasing the appropriation under Category B by $400,000 and adjusting the program and operating appropriations totals accordingly; 2) adding a new Capital Improvement Project under Water Fund - Unrestricted entitled "1888 Wili Pa Loop Building Improvements" in the amount of $400,000; and 3) amending Appendix C to add a new project and project description for 1888 Wili Pa Loop Building Improvements in the amount of $400,000.   Action details Video Video
Bill 107 (2023) 1Bill"A BILL FOR AN ORDINANCE AMENDING THE FISCAL YEAR 2024 BUDGET FOR THE COUNTY OF MAUI, DEPARTMENT OF FIRE AND PUBLIC SAFETY, ADMINISTRATION PROGRAM AND TRAINING PROGRAM" The purpose of this bill is to amend the Fiscal Year 2024 Budget, Department of Fire and Public Safety, Administration Program by decreasing the equivalent personnel by 2.0 and the appropriation under Category A by $82,884 and increasing the equivalent personnel and the appropriation under Category A for the Training Program in the same amount.   Action details Video Video
Bill 108 (2023) 1Bill"A BILL FOR AN ORDINANCE AMENDING THE FISCAL YEAR 2024 BUDGET FOR THE COUNTY OF MAUI, APPENDIX B, DEPARTMENT OF WATER SUPPLY" The purpose of this bill is to add two new categories: Emergency Water Charge and Temporary Irrigation Charge.   Action details Video Video
Bill 109 (2023) 1Bill"A BILL FOR AN ORDINANCE AMENDING THE FISCAL YEAR 2024 BUDGET FOR THE COUNTY OF MAUI, APPENDIX A, PART I, OFFICE OF THE MAYOR" The purpose of this bill is to amend the Fiscal Year 2024 Budget, Appendix A, Part I, Office of the Mayor, by increasing the appropriation for the Community Development Block Grant (CDBG) Program by $1,478,750; deleting projects for Maui Family Support Services, Inc. and County of Maui, Department of Fire and Public Safety; adding a project for County of Maui; and adding a new appropriation for "CDBG-Coronavirus Program" in the amount of $1,726,202 with line items for a project for County of Maui and Program Administration.   Action details Video Video
Bill 110 (2023) 1Bill"A BILL FOR AN ORDINANCE AMENDING THE FISCAL YEAR 2024 BUDGET FOR THE COUNTY OF MAUI, DEPARTMENT OF FINANCE, COUNTYWIDE COSTS; DEPARTMENT OF MANAGEMENT; APPENDIX A, PART I, DEPARTMENT OF MANAGEMENT; AND APPENDIX A, PART II, EMERGENCY FUND" The purpose of this bill is to amend the Fiscal Year 2024 Budget, by 1) decreasing the Department of Finance, Countywide Costs, Emergency Fund, by $20,603,895; 2) adding a new program under Department of Management entitled "Office of Recovery"; 3) adding a new grant entitled "Private Donations" in the amount of $200,000; 4) decreasing the appropriation in Appendix A, Part II, Emergency Fund in the amount of $20,603,895, and adjusting the totals accordingly, and adding new conditional language for a Lahaina Wildfire Final Disposition Site and Department of Fire and Public Safety.   Action details Video Video
Bill 111 (2023) 1Bill"A BILL FOR AN ORDINANCE AMENDING CHAPTER 3.100, MAUI COUNTY CODE, RELATING TO GENERAL EXCISE AND USE TAX SURCHARGE" The purpose of this bill is to allocate 80 percent of all funds received from the general excise tax and use surcharge to the general excise tax fund; 2) establish a new Section 3.100.021 entitled "General excise tax fund - Department of Hawaiian Home Lands" and allocating 20 percent of all funds received from the general excise tax and use surcharge; and 3) amend Section 3.100.040, Maui County Code to delete Subsection (C), and add the general excise tax fund - Department of Hawaiian Home Lands to the final section.   Action details Video Video
Bill 112 (2023) 1Bill"A BILL FOR AN ORDINANCE AMENDING THE FISCAL YEAR 2024 BUDGET FOR THE COUNTY OF MAUI, REVENUES; DEPARTMENT OF FINANCE, COUNTYWIDE COSTS; AND APPENDIX A, PART II, GENERAL EXCISE TAX FUND AND GENERAL EXCISE TAX FUND - DEPARTMENT OF HAWAIIAN HOME LANDS" The purpose of this bill is to amend the Fiscal Year 2024 Budget, by 1) adding "General Excise Tax" to the section entitled "From Taxes, Fees and Assessments" in the amount of $20,000,000 and increasing the total accordingly; 2) adding two appropriations under Department of Finance, Countywide Costs; 3) revising the reference in Section 14 of the General Budget Provisions; and 4) adding the General Excise Tax Fund with conditional language for three projects.   Action details Not available
Bill 113 (2023) 1Bill"A BILL FOR AN ORDINANCE AMENDING SUBSECTION 2.96.100(B), MAUI COUNTY CODE, RELATING TO THE ELIGIBILITY CRITERIA FOR RENTAL RESIDENTIAL WORKFORCE HOUSING UNITS" The purpose of this bill is to expand eligibility to individuals or families displaced by an emergency under Chapter 127A, HRS; or those who are income and asset qualified but held a disqualifying interest in real property within the last three years.   Action details Video Video
Bill No. 66, CD1, FD1 (2023) 1Ordinance"A BILL FOR AN ORDINANCE AMENDING CHAPTER 16.04D, MAUI COUNTY CODE, RELATING TO INSPECTIONS AND TO CORRECT AN OMISSION" The purpose of this bill is to allow for fire inspections on commercial activities conducted outside normal business hours or at distant locations to be charged a fee, and to correct a previously omitted Department of Water Supply exception for building fire flow requirements for first and second dwellings.   Action details Video Video
